Participant Reaction

The immediate feedback or feelings of individuals after engaging in a training or educational activity, often used as an initial measure of the program's effectiveness.

Training Effectiveness

Refers to the extent to which training improves the performance and capabilities of employees in an organizational setting.

Orientation Programs

Training sessions designed to introduce new employees to their job duties, the company's policies, and the organizational culture.

Organization's Rules

Specific guidelines and regulations that govern behavior and processes within an organization.
